The Early Warning French Window

The Early Warning French Window David J Walker The unmistakable tapping At the protruding French windows in The breakfast nook Is the early warning system I’ve relied on betraying the otherwise Silent arrival of a wintery day Sleet and ice announce its Comings and goings before the unseen dawn The darkness extended to noon Gray will be the color of today Pitched against the icy white And I might just stay Right here Watching the world from my French Window
